I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Python Discussion :

Afficher un texte modifiable pour le renvoyer au programme


Sujet :

Python

Vue hybride

Message précédent Message précédent   Message suivant Message suivant
  1. #1
    Membre averti
    Homme Profil pro
    L1 MI
    Inscrit en
    Février 2014
    Messages
    17
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France

    Informations professionnelles :
    Activité : L1 MI

    Informations forums :
    Inscription : Février 2014
    Messages : 17
    Par défaut Afficher un texte modifiable pour le renvoyer au programme
    Bonjour/Bonsoir

    J'ai fais un petit "programme" qui analyse des fichiers dans un dossier et les renomme si besoin.

    Lorsqu'il les renomme j'aimerai pouvoir valider et modifier si besoin la chaîne de caractère.

    Mon idée est que dans l'invite de commande le nom du fichier modifier par le programme apparaisse et que j'ai juste à faire <enter> pour valider ou (et c'est là ou je ne sais pas si c'est possible puisque je n'ai pas trouver de solution) modifier le texte apparu et valider avec <enter>.

    En gros je veux que le programme renvoie du texte modifiable directement, pour que j'ai pas à retaper les 3/4 du nom du fichier, et le renvoyer ensuite au programme.

    Le nom de fichier est en string.

    Voilà j'espère que ma question est compréhensible et qu'une solution existe pour ce problème de fainéantise !

    Edit : et j'aimerai que tout ce passe dans l'invite de commande de windows 10 ^^'

  2. #2
    Expert confirmé Avatar de BufferBob
    Profil pro
    responsable R&D vidage de truites
    Inscrit en
    Novembre 2010
    Messages
    3 041
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ations professionnelles :
    Activité : responsable R&D vidage de truites

    Informations forums :
    Inscription : Novembre 2010
    Messages : 3 041
    Par défaut
    salut,

    Citation Envoyé par Hairah Voir le message
    dans l'invite de commande le nom du fichier modifier par le programme apparaisse et que j'ai juste à faire <enter> pour valider ou (et c'est là ou je ne sais pas si c'est possible puisque je n'ai pas trouver de solution) modifier le texte apparu et valider avec <enter>.

    En gros je veux que le programme renvoie du texte modifiable directement, pour que j'ai pas à retaper les 3/4 du nom du fichier, et le renvoyer ensuite au programme.
    (...)
    Edit : et j'aimerai que tout ce passe dans l'invite de commande de windows 10 ^^'
    si je comprends bien tu voudrais par exemple pouvoir te déplacer dans le nom de fichier avec les flèches, insérer des caractères, en supprimer etc. puis appuyer sur [Entrée] pour valider c'est bien ça ?

    réponse courte : dans l'invite de commande de windows, c'est sans doute pas impossible (en bidouillant plus ou moins crado) mais ça s'annonce compliqué, comme sortir un bazooka pour dégommer une mouche

    enfin vu d'ici, peut-être que quelqu'un aura une solution adaptée à te proposer mais là comme ça j'en connais pas

  3. #3
    Expert confirmé

    Homme Profil pro
    Inscrit en
    Octobre 2008
    Messages
    4 307
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Belgique

    Informations forums :
    Inscription : Octobre 2008
    Messages : 4 307
    Par défaut
    Salut,

    Je ne pense pas non plus que ce soit possible.

    Pour la simple raison que je ne l'ai jamais vu, alors que ce serait une fonctionnalité utile.


    Edit: Jette un oeil au module curses, peut-être ...

  4. #4
    Membre averti
    Homme Profil pro
    L1 MI
    Inscrit en
    Février 2014
    Messages
    17
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France

    Informations professionnelles :
    Activité : L1 MI

    Informations forums :
    Inscription : Février 2014
    Messages : 17
    Par défaut
    Après de nombreuses recherches sans succès j'ai abandonné !
    Je copie dans le presse papier à l'aide de pyperclip le nom de fichier et un petit input.
    Si il n'y a pas besoin de modifier juste un petit entrer sinon ctrl+v et je modifie voilà ^^

    Pour ce qui est de curses, impossible de l'importer alors qu'il est bien dans l'installation de python.. Donc j'ai pas cherché plus loin ^^'

    En tout cas merci pour vos réponses !

  5. #5
    Expert confirmé Avatar de BufferBob
    Profil pro
    responsable R&D vidage de truites
    Inscrit en
    Novembre 2010
    Messages
    3 041
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ations professionnelles :
    Activité : responsable R&D vidage de truites

    Informations forums :
    Inscription : Novembre 2010
    Messages : 3 041
    Par défaut
    Citation Envoyé par Hairah Voir le message
    Je copie dans le presse papier à l'aide de pyperclip le nom de fichier et un petit input.
    Si il n'y a pas besoin de modifier juste un petit entrer sinon ctrl+v et je modifie voilà ^^
    c'est malin en effet

    Pour ce qui est de curses, impossible de l'importer alors qu'il est bien dans l'installation de python..
    ouai {n,}curses directement y'a pas, de ce que j'ai cru comprendre y'a un remplaçant du nom de UniCurses, à voir ce que ça vaut... sinon comme dit y'a toujours moyen, en jouant sur les séquences d'échappement mais ce sont pas les séquences ANSI donc faudrait tâtonner un peu plus encore

    pour info,

Discussions similaires

  1. Problème pour afficher du texte modifié dans un JLabel
    Par Gordon Freeman dans le forum Agents de placement/Fenêtres
    Réponses: 3
    Dernier message: 03/06/2009, 15h25
  2. [VBA-E] Afficher une feuille excel pour la modifier
    Par z980x dans le forum Macros et VBA Excel
    Réponses: 6
    Dernier message: 30/05/2006, 22h21
  3. Besoin d'aide pour afficher du text dans un applet
    Par argon dans le forum Applets
    Réponses: 2
    Dernier message: 15/01/2006, 21h53
  4. bouton image pour afficher du texte
    Par froggies dans le forum Général JavaScript
    Réponses: 4
    Dernier message: 17/10/2005, 12h09

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o